I am Tekkan. I have married the poetic forms of the sonnet and the tanka. A story is told in the sonnet - using three quatrains, and a final couplet. The story reaches a conclusion in the couplet. The tanka offers a commentary or counterpoint to the sonnet - the combined poems have two endings. The meaning is direct - I want people to understand clearly. Metaphors are inspired by Shakespeare, the (aimed-for) precision imitates the Japanese. Mixing the sonnet with the tanka combines the sensibility of the Occident and the Orient - as I have done by living in America, England, and Japan. The subjects covered in Everyday Mind X include - parcel my stupidity - bee hummingbird - funhouse mirrors - stardust and gravity - saying hippopotamus - a ball bouncing down a mountain - imagine myself a tomato.  Tekkan is the dharma name I was given. I use Zen mediation to make poetry of ordinary events. Tekkan means, Iron Man, a settled practitioner of great determination.
